Odoo Multi Warehouse Management: Inventory by Location & Sales Control

Odoo Multi Warehouse Management: Inventory by Location & Sales Control

Managing inventory across multiple warehouses in standard Odoo can become challenging for growing businesses. While Odoo provides basic warehouse functionality, companies operating across regional branches, distribution centers, or multiple storage locations often require deeper control over inventory allocation, warehouse-specific sales operations, and real-time stock visibility.

The Odoo Multi Warehouse Management module enhances Odoo’s inventory capabilities by providing precise warehouse-wise stock management and advanced inventory tracking by location. Businesses can monitor live stock quantities across multiple warehouses, assign products from specific warehouses directly within sales orders, and streamline logistics operations without manual coordination.

This module is especially valuable for wholesalers, retailers, manufacturers, and multi-branch organizations that need accurate inventory distribution and faster order fulfillment. By integrating warehouse selection directly into the sales workflow, businesses can reduce delays, improve operational transparency, and eliminate inventory discrepancies.

Additionally, the module automates delivery operations by intelligently splitting deliveries when products originate from different warehouses. This ensures smooth logistics execution while maintaining accurate inventory synchronization across all locations in real time.

Real-World Problem

Why does standard Odoo struggle to provide granular inventory control and warehouse-specific sales management for businesses operating across multiple warehouse locations?

How This App Solves the Real-World Problem

The Odoo Multi Warehouse Management module introduces advanced warehouse-level inventory visibility directly into Odoo’s sales and inventory workflows. Instead of relying on a global stock quantity, users can track product availability warehouse-by-warehouse and location-by-location.

Sales teams gain the ability to select the exact warehouse for each product line during order creation. This ensures accurate inventory allocation and prevents confusion during fulfillment. The system also validates live stock availability before confirming the order, reducing stock conflicts and operational errors.

For orders involving products stored in different warehouses, the module automatically creates separate delivery orders for each location. This eliminates manual splitting processes, improves warehouse coordination, and ensures faster and more organized delivery management.

Key Features

  • Warehouse-Wise Stock Tracking
    Monitor real-time inventory quantities for every warehouse and location.

  • Warehouse Selection in Sales Orders
    Choose the source warehouse directly on each sales order line.

  • Automatic Delivery Splitting
    Generate separate delivery orders for products sourced from multiple warehouses.

  • Inventory by Location Management
    Track stock movement with detailed location-level visibility.

  • Real-Time Stock Validation
    Ensure accurate inventory allocation during sales operations.

  • Improved Logistics Coordination
    Streamline warehouse operations and reduce fulfillment delays.

  • Seamless Odoo Integration
    Works directly within standard Odoo inventory and sales workflows.

Comparison (Standard Odoo vs Multi Warehouse Management Module)

Feature
Standard Odoo Inventory
Multi Warehouse Management Module

Warehouse Visibility

Basic warehouse management

Advanced warehouse & location tracking

Stock View

Global stock quantity

Warehouse-wise real-time stock

Warehouse Selection in Sale Orders

Limited

Per product line selection

Delivery Handling

Manual coordination

Automatic delivery splitting

Inventory Allocation

Basic

Real-time warehouse allocation

Multi-Warehouse Fulfillment

Limited flexibility

Fully optimized workflow

Logistics Transparency

Partial

Complete operational visibility

Conclusion

While standard Odoo provides essential inventory management features, businesses operating across multiple warehouses often require more advanced operational control. The Odoo Multi Warehouse Management module bridges this gap by introducing warehouse-level visibility, intelligent inventory allocation, and automated logistics coordination.

By enabling real-time stock tracking and warehouse-specific sales fulfillment, the module helps organizations improve supply chain efficiency, reduce fulfillment errors, and optimize inventory distribution. For companies managing distributed inventory networks, this module becomes a critical enhancement to Odoo’s warehouse management ecosystem.

FAQs

1. Does standard Odoo support advanced multi-warehouse allocation?

Odoo supports multiple warehouses, but advanced warehouse-wise sales allocation is limited without this module.

2. Can I select different warehouses within the same sales order?

Yes, this module allows warehouse selection for each individual order line.

3. Does the system automatically split deliveries?

Yes, delivery orders are automatically separated based on warehouse sources.

4. Can I track inventory by storage location?

Yes, the module provides detailed inventory tracking by location.

5. Is stock availability updated in real time?

Yes, the system validates live stock quantities across warehouses.

6. Is this module suitable for wholesalers and distributors?

Yes, it is specifically beneficial for businesses managing distributed inventory

7. Does the module require complex configuration?

No, setup is straightforward and integrates easily with standard Odoo settings.
Scroll to Top